Palm84 某所の日記

有為のクマにかくれり~

CSS

見ての通りなんですが、はてなのテーマを外して自作のスタイルシートに替えてみました。(リンクではなくembedですが)

知り合いには「おまえらしく、一段とダサさ爆発!」とのありがたい評価をいただきました。(怒

それはいいのですが、IEでの表示が一部おかしくなります。

  • スクロールした際に、[background-color]の指定が無効になる
  • アンカーにカーソルを置いた時に、[border]の指定などが無効になる

継承についてチェックしたり、無駄な2重指定などを見直せば治ると思うのですが、時間がないのでとりあえず放置になってます。IEでご覧になられてる方すみません。原因がわかれば治しますので。

blockquote,pre 要素あたりもう少し修正が必要だと思ってます。overflow 属性でスクロールさせたい場合とbox内で自動改行して欲しい場合と両方あるので。この辺はIEとFirefoxでは表示がかなり違ってくるのでややこしいです。設定変えると表示が逆転したりとかしてあれ〜ってなってます。(汗

あと、ネタ元は忘れましたが(多分2ch?)、Mozillaで長いURLなどの表示をbox内で自動改行させる(はみ出しちゃったりしますよね?)のにこんな技があるんですね。独自拡張みたいですけど

white-space: -moz-pre-wrap;

validator さんには「エラーだ!」と怒られてしまいますけど・・・。ん?あれ?検索したら出て来ますね。。独自拡張って色々あるんですね(滝汗。

っていうか、あきらめてまた元に戻しちゃうかもしれませんけど。